Ingredients You’ll Need

Don’t let the ingredient list fool you—this Blueberry Fluffy Cottage Cheese Cloud Bread Recipe only requires a handful of essentials, each playing a crucial role in creating that perfect texture and flavor. From the creamy cottage cheese to the bursting sweet blueberries, every element makes a difference.

  • 1 cup cottage cheese: Adds moisture and a tangy creaminess that forms the bread’s base.
  • 3 large eggs: Provide structure and the fluffy lift, especially when the whites are whipped to stiff peaks.
  • 1/2 cup almond flour: Gives a subtle nuttiness and helps bind the ingredients without weighing them down.
  • 1/4 teaspoon baking powder: Enhances lightness by introducing gentle rise.
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t: Balances the sweetness and elevates all flavors.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: Adds warmth and depth to the flavor profile.
  • 1 tablespoon honey: Brings just the right amount of natural sweetness.
  • 1/2 cup fresh blueberries: Bursts of juicy flavor and a gorgeous pop of color.
  • 1/4 teaspoon cream of tartar: Stabilizes the egg whites to give you that perfect fluffy texture.

How to Make Blueberry Fluffy Cottage Cheese Cloud Bread Recipe

Step 1: Preheat and Prepare

Begin by heating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per, which will prevent any sticking and make cleanup a breeze. This little step ensures that your cloud breads come off perfectly intact and with ease.

Step 2: Mix the Base Ingredients

Grab a medium bowl and combine the cottage cheese, eggs, almond flour, baking powder, and salt. Whisk these ingredients together until the mixture is smooth and you don’t see any lumps. This forms the rich, creamy base of your cloud bread.

Step 3: Add Flavor and Sweetness

Next, stir in the vanilla extract and honey, whisking again until everything is fully incorporated. These add those subtle layers of flavor and just enough sweetness to complement the natural tartness of the cottage cheese and blueberries.

Step 4: Whip the Egg Whites

In a separate clean bowl, sprinkle the cream of tartar over the egg whites. Using an electric mixer or hand whisk, beat them until stiff peaks form—this means when you lift your whisk, the peaks stand upright without drooping. This step is key to achieving the light and fluffy texture of the cloud bread.

Step 5: Fold in the Egg Whites

Carefully and gently fold the beaten egg whites into your cottage cheese mixture. Take your time here to avoid deflating the whites because their airiness is what gives you that beautiful cloud-like softness.

Step 6: Incorporate the Blueberries

Gently fold in the fresh blueberries, spreading them evenly throughout the batter. The goal is to have juicy pops of flavor in every bite without bursting them too much during mixing.

Step 7: Shape and Bake

Using a spoon, scoop the mixture onto the parchment-lined baking sheet, forming round, fluffy mounds that resemble little clouds. Leave some space between each one to allow for gentle spreading as they bake. Pop the tray into the oven and bake for 20 to 25 minutes, until the tops turn a lovely golden brown and feel firm to the touch.

Step 8: Cool and Enjoy

Once done, take the cloud breads out of the oven and let them sit on the baking sheet for a few minutes to cool slightly. Then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ely. This helps maintain their delicate structure and ensures they are perfectly light and airy when you serve them.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

If you have leftovers,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two days, or refrigerate to extend their freshness. Keeping them covered helps retain their delicate moisture without becoming soggy.

Freezing

For longer storage, freeze the cloud breads in a single layer on a baking sheet until solid, then transfer to a freezer-safe bag. They can be frozen for up to a month without losing their fluffy texture.

Reheating

To enjoy them warm, simply toast the cloud bread lightly or warm them in the oven at a low temperature for a few minutes. This brings back their fresh-from-the-oven softness and highlights the sweet blueberry bursts beautifully.

FAQs

Can I use frozen blueberries in this recipe?

Yes, you can use frozen blueberries if fresh aren’t available. Just be sure to thaw and drain them well to avoid excess moisture that could make the batter too wet.

Is this bread gluten-free?

Absolutely! Thanks to the almond flour and absence of traditional wheat flour, this Blueberry Fluffy Cottage Cheese Cloud Bread Recipe is naturally gluten-free and suitable for those avoiding gluten.

Can I substitute the cottage cheese?

You can try ricotta as a substitute for cottage cheese for a similar texture and taste, but avoid using cream cheese as it will change the consistency too much.

How do I know when the cloud bread is done baking?

You want the tops to turn a gentle golden brown and the breads to feel firm but still soft when touched. A slight spring back indicates they’re ready.

Is this recipe suitable for a low-carb diet?

Yes, the almond flour and cottage cheese combination makes this bread a low-carb option, perfect for keto or other low-carb eating plans.

Notes

  • Be careful when folding the egg whites to maintain the fluffy texture of the cloud bread.
  • Fresh blueberries give the best flavor and texture; frozen berries may add extra moisture and alter baking time.
  • This bread is best eaten the same day but can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days.
  • You can substitute honey with a sugar-free sweetener to reduce sugar content if desired.
  • Almond flour is key for structure and low carbs; do not substitute with regular flour if aiming for a low-carb version.
